Application Scenario:
In a temperature control system, MAX5259EEE can be utilized to generate analog control signals for regulating heating or cooling elements based on the digital temperature readings.
Circuit Design:
To effectively utilize MAX5259EEE in a temperature control system, consider the following design optimizations:
1. Power Management:
Ensure stable power supply to MAX5259EEE and associated components. Use low-noise voltage regulators and proper decoupling capacitors to minimize power supply noise and ensure reliable operation.
2. Signal Integrity:
Minimize noise and interference in the analog signal path by carefully routing traces, minimizing ground loops, and using proper grounding techniques. Shield sensitive analog traces from digital noise sources to maintain signal integrity.
3. Thermal Management:
Optimize thermal dissipation for MAX5259EEE to prevent overheating and ensure long-term reliability. Place thermal vias under the device and provide adequate heat sinking if necessary, especially in high-temperature environments.
4. Layout Considerations:
Follow recommended layout guidelines provided in the MAX5259EEE datasheet to minimize parasitic effects, reduce crosstalk, and optimize performance. Pay attention to component placement and trace routing to minimize signal distortion and maximize accuracy.
5. System Calibration:
Calibrate the system to compensate for any non-idealities in MAX5259EEE and the overall temperature control loop. Implement calibration routines to ensure accurate analog output over the entire temperature range and compensate for any offset or gain errors.
Considerations:
When designing with MAX5259EEE, keep in mind the following considerations:
- Resolution and Accuracy: Take advantage of the high resolution and accuracy of MAX5259EEE to achieve precise analog output for temperature control applications.
- Output Filtering: Implement low-pass filtering to remove any high-frequency noise or artifacts from the DAC output, ensuring smooth and stable analog control signals.
- Environmental Factors: Consider environmental factors such as temperature variations, humidity, and vibration, and design the system to operate reliably under varying conditions.
- Test and Validation: Thoroughly test the temperature control system to validate the performance of MAX5259EEE and ensure that it meets the required specifications under different operating conditions.
